Recently i have a good biographical book on Dr. (Nitu)Nityanand Mandke. Dr. Nitu Mandke was a well known cardiologist who performed a open heart surgery on Balasaheb Thakre- a prominent figure in Indian politics.This book is written by his wife a leading anesthesiiest dr. Alka Manke.

Dr.Nitu Mandke was born on 1st Jan 1948. Born and brought up in pune. after completing his high school studies he joined in B. J. Medical College. This was the place where he met his would be wife Dr. Alka Mandke. Dr. Nitu was a well known and brillant student throughout. He was very keen on sports, a boxing champion, a captain of soccer tem and long runner. He was very frank about his opinions since childhood.Dr. Neetu propsed Alka in a very innovative way during their second year. This proposal was accepted by both the families after little bit of tension and mis-communication.Both the families agreed to the marriage and it was decided that the engagement should be done now and after completing the studies both of them will be married. After completing his formal MBBS education from BJ Medical college he joined KEM Hospital in Mumbai to complete his post graduation in Cardio- thoraic surgery.
Once Dr. Neetu went to study in mumbai, Alka took admission for anesthesia in Pune But she made it a point that Neetu writes ever y small detail in letters and every weekend Alka visited Neetu in mumbai. Love flourished between them. Alkas family where reluctant that the marriage is not taking place as planned and Alka was caught between love and tradition.

After completing Post graduation and working for some period of time, He left for UK for studying further developments in surgery as well as working in general hospital in UK. It was then he got a good exposure in cardiac surgery. After working for some period he went to Bristol to work in hospital. By that time, Alka had completed her education, was married to him and had a beautiful daughter. Dr. Neetu was staying in utter poverty their but the relatives thought other wise. It happend once that Dr.Neetu had to pay 65 pounds as fee but he earned only 15 pounds per week. The last option was to ask somebody for help. One of his relatives friend was staying in UK. He borrowed the money from him. After his exams, Dr.Neetu returned the money and invited him for lunch. The gentleman was throughly pleaed with his genuineness.
Further he called his wife and daughter to UK. Dr. Alka joined a hospital to gather experience there.Life was full of questions ahead but Dr still found the light at the end of tunnel.
Further he wen to US for his further studies and sent Alka and daughter back to India. When Dr. Alka returned to India, they were homeless and jobless. Staying at one of the relatives place, Alka started applying for the job in various hospitals. But she could not get job in a government hospital due to lack of experience. Her experience in UK was not considered. Finally she got a part time job in a private hospital for a monthly salary of rs.1500 only.But this did not beat her spirits.
After working under Dr.Picasio- renowed doctor from US, Dr. Nitu returned to India for serving people. Here he did not get the job very easily and started workingas consulatant for JJ hospital. Other surgeons were impressed by his skill in cardiac surgery. He performed operation from a month old blue baby to a 70 year old person will same confidence and patience.He was a skilled surgeon, nicknamed ‘Super-fast’ because he operated with such speed and precision.Dr. Alka assisted in anstheology for his operations. Together they were a team.Dr. Mandke was an energetic and dynamic person with an inimitable sense of humor. He was frank with everybody who came in contact with him, to the extent of being sometimes appearing brusque, but this was only momentary, and then he was back to his jovial self. He made friends easily, and his patients loved him.

Dr>Neetu came in to lime light when he performed a surgery on Balashaeb Thakre. Pubilicity and money followed. He then performed many operation on celebrities and sport persons.He nutured a dream of building a super speciality cardiac hospital for people.

He was driving home after finishing his clinic at Kemps Corner – a daily routine, when he experienced some uneasiness and informed his wife that he would be going to the hospital, as he was getting some chest pain. He stopped at the Hinduja Hospital, told the doctors that he was having a heart attack and instructed them as to the treatment. He fought for life for two days in spite of multiple cardiac arrests treated with electric shocks, angiography, and angioplasty, but finally succumbed- as God had willed
He was a dreamer who nurtured the thought of building a state of the art heart hospital to benefit society, and almost made it a reality by building a large 18 story structure, designed to be Asia’s No. 1 heart hospital, but which is unfortunately incomplete at the time of his passing.
The new state of art hospital will now bear Ambani name and not Dr. Neetu Mandkes but Dr.Alka put forward her brave face. ‘‘The dream of one visionary is being completed as a tribute to another visionary,’’ says Dr Alka Mandke. The only thing is Dr. Neetu Manke will be cherished as agreat visionary, a great cardiac surgeon a good father.
